Scientific Name: Cirsium canescens Common Name: prairie thistle Origin: Native Notes: Each species in this genus is designated a "Primary Noxious Weed" by Iowa law. Habitat: disturbed places and shortgrass prairies, usually in sandy or gravely soils. Reported in NW Iowa—rare if present. raleigh refrigeration and iceWebFacts.
